Rainer Fislage is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ine and Genetics. According to data from OpenAlex, Rainer Fislage has authored 14 papers receiving a total of 312 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 5 papers in Pulmonary and Respiratory Medicine and 3 papers in Genetics. Recurrent topics in Rainer Fislage's work include Cystic Fibrosis Research Advances (5 papers), RNA and protein synthesis mechanisms (4 papers) and RNA modifications and cancer (2 papers). Rainer Fislage is often cited by papers focused on Cystic Fibrosis Research Advances (5 papers), RNA and protein synthesis mechanisms (4 papers) and RNA modifications and cancer (2 papers). Rainer Fislage collaborates with scholars based in Germany. Rainer Fislage's co-authors include Brigitte Wulf, Thomas Neumann, Burkhard Tümmler, Maria Wendt, Thilo Dörk, Burkhard TÃ ⁄ mmler, Meinhard Hahn, Alfred Pingoud, Walter Sierralta and Frauke Mekus and has published in prestigious journals such as Nucleic Acids Research, Journal of Biological Chemistry and Human Molecular Genetics.
